Contractbook is a comprehensive contract management platform that helps businesses streamline their contract creation, management, and storage processes. It is designed to simplify and digitize the entire lifecycle of contracts, from drafting and negotiating to signing and archiving. With its user-friendly interface and powerful features, Contractbook empowers organizations to improve efficiency, reduce risk, and maintain better control over their contracts.

Here are ten important things you need to know about Contractbook:

1. Contractbook is a cloud-based platform: Contractbook operates as a cloud-based software-as-a-service (SaaS) platform, which means that users can access their contracts and related documents securely from anywhere with an internet connection. This flexibility allows for efficient collaboration and ensures that all stakeholders can access and manage contracts in real-time.

2. Efficient contract creation and drafting: With Contractbook, you can create contracts from scratch or use pre-designed templates. The platform offers a user-friendly editor that simplifies the drafting process, enabling you to customize contracts based on your specific needs. It also supports dynamic variables, allowing for the automated insertion of personalized data into contracts, such as client names or contract dates.

3. Streamlined contract negotiation: Contractbook facilitates seamless collaboration during contract negotiations. Multiple parties can work together on a contract simultaneously, making edits, leaving comments, and tracking changes. This collaborative approach enhances transparency, reduces bottlenecks, and speeds up the negotiation process.

4. Secure e-signatures: Contractbook includes an integrated electronic signature feature, ensuring the legality and security of digital signatures. Users can request signatures from counterparties directly within the platform, eliminating the need for printing, scanning, and mailing documents. The e-signature feature complies with industry standards and regulations, making it a legally binding and secure method of signing contracts.

5. Contract lifecycle management: Contractbook provides a centralized repository for storing and organizing contracts throughout their lifecycle. It enables you to categorize contracts by different parameters, such as contract type, counterparty, or expiration date. This categorization makes it easy to locate contracts quickly, ensuring efficient management and reducing the risk of missing critical deadlines.

6. Automated reminders and notifications: To help you stay on top of important dates and obligations, Contractbook offers automated reminders and notifications. You can set up alerts for contract renewal dates, payment deadlines, or other relevant milestones. These reminders ensure that you never miss crucial contract events, helping you manage your contracts more effectively.

7. Integrations with other tools: Contractbook integrates with popular business tools, such as CRM systems, project management software, and document management platforms. These integrations allow for seamless data transfer and synchronization, ensuring that contract information remains consistent across various systems. Integration with third-party tools enhances productivity and reduces the need for manual data entry.

8. Advanced analytics and reporting: Contractbook provides detailed analytics and reporting features that offer insights into contract performance, trends, and risks. You can generate customized reports to track metrics like contract volume, average negotiation time, or revenue generated from contracts. These analytics help you make data-driven decisions, identify areas for improvement, and assess the overall health of your contract management process.

9. Compliance and security: Contractbook prioritizes data security and compliance with global privacy regulations, such as GDPR. The platform implements robust security measures, including data encryption, access controls, and regular backups. Contractbook also offers features to help you maintain compliance, such as consent management, data retention policies, and audit trails.

10. Customer support and resources: Contractbook provides comprehensive customer support, including live chat, email support, and extensive documentation. They also offer training resources, webinars, and tutorials to help users maximize the platform’s capabilities and address any queries or issues that may arise. Their commitment to customer success ensures that users can leverage Contractbook to its full potential.
